Consejos útiles

Que significa R1 y R0 en programacion?

¿Qué significa R1 y R0 en programación?

Los registros R1-R7 son registros de 16 bits que se pueden utilizar como registros fuente y destino en operaciones aritmeticológicas. El registro R0 es un registro especial, también de 16 bits, que siempre contiene el valor 0.

¿Cómo funciona el CMP en ensamblador?

Instrucción CMP Propósito: Comparar los operandos. Esta instrucción resta el operando fuente al operando destino pero sin que éste almacene el resultado de la operación, solo se afecta el estado de las banderas.

¿Qué es un flag en ensamblador?

– FLAGS (banderas): Indica la condición del microcontrolador y controla su operación. – DS (datos): Indica el segmento de memoria que contiene los utilizados por el programa. Se accede a los datos por medio de un desplazamiento o a través del contenido de otros registros que contienen la dirección de desplazamiento.

¿Cómo funciona XOR en ensamblador?

Instrucción XOR Su función es efectuar bit por bit la disyunción exclusiva lógica de los dos operandos.

¿Cómo hacer una comparacion en ensamblador?

En lenguaje ensamblador no existe la instrucción IF como se trabaja en otros lenguajes para comparar y tomar decisiones, para esto se utiliza cmp en conjunto con los saltos.

¿Cómo funciona la instrucción call?

La instrucción CALL. CALL en idioma inglés significa ‘llamada’, y nos permite ejecutar un procedimiento repetidas veces en diversos momentos del programa sin necesidad de reescribir las mismas instrucciones una y otra vez. Por decirlo así esto es un ejemplo de programación estructurada.

¿Qué hace la instruccion and?

Instrucción AND. Descripción: AND realiza el AND lógico entre el contenido del registro Rd y del registro Rr, y deja el resultado en el registro destino Rd. V: 0, borrado. N: Estará a set si el bit MSB del resultado está a set, de lo contrario se borrará.

¿Qué es equ?

EQU. = equivale a 1 (verdadero) si sus dos operandos son idénticos en valor, o equivale a 0 (falso) si sus dos operandos no son idénticos en valor.

¿Qué son los saltos condicionales en lenguaje ensamblador?

Los saltos condicionales transfieren el control del programa a la ubicación que se les dé como parámetro si al hacer una comparación se cumple la condición establecida en el salto, los saltos condicionales son los siguientes: JA (Jump if Above):

¿Qué es el offset en lenguaje ensamblador?

En ingeniería informática y programación de bajo nivel (como el lenguaje ensamblador), un offset normalmente indica el número de posiciones de memoria sumadas a una dirección base para conseguir una dirección absoluta específica. …

¿Qué es el error de offset?

En un conversor o convertidor, el Error de offset (Offset error) es el valor de tensión que debe aplicarse a la entrada para tener una salida digital nula. Se debe al offset del comparador y se expresa en mV o en LSB nominales.

¿Qué es el offset en un sistema de control?

Una consecuencia de la aplicación del control proporcional al lazo básico de control es el offset. Offset significa que el controlador mantendrá la medida a un valor diferente del valor de consigna. Esto es mas fácilmente visto al observar la figura.

¿Qué es un amplificador de error?

Amplificador de error. El amplificador de error detecta la caída en la salida del regulador , mediante la comparación del monitoreo de la salida y el voltaje de referencia , cuando la salida decrece el amplificador provoca que el elemento de control force a subir el voltaje de salida a su nivel deseado .

¿Cómo se mide el voltaje offset?

Si la anchura de la rueda es de diez pulgadas, se divide por dos para obtener una línea central de cinco pulgadas. Reste la línea central de la tecla de retroceso para obtener el offset. En este ejemplo, 4 – 5 = -1. A continuación, el desplazamiento es -1 pulgada.

¿Qué es el voltaje offset de una señal?

El offset de una señal alterna se puede definir como el nivel de continua que le suma a una señal alterna. Así, si la señal está centrada en el origen, se dice que el nivel de offset es 0. Si está desplazada hacia arriba, el offset es positivo, mientras que si está desplazada hacia abajo, lo será negativo.